> > >Can I can
> > >turn the machine off, boot using the live CD again the next day
> and
> > >continue where I left off?
> > >  
> > >
> > Yes.  Of course when you restart, you need to remount all your 
> > partitions for the new lfs.
> > 
> > When you get to chapter six, you must also redo the following
> > sections:
> > 
> > 6.2. Mounting Virtual Kernel File Systems
> > 6.3. Entering the chroot environment
> > and lastly
> > 6.8. Populating /dev
